Transaction 57fafa1d1792f94abc0cef0bda12246074de427a796005c9e3884e603ca814c2
1 Input
1 Output
-
57fafa1d1792f94abc0cef0bda12246074de427a796005c9e3884e603ca814c2:0
- value
- 757758
- script pubkey
- OP_0 OP_PUSHBYTES_20 a970b2040227ae5ece3da31bf245c44a3baabdfd
- address
- bc1q49ctypqzy7h9an3a5vdly3wyfga6400ayuryct